Morgan Barron, Josh Morrissey, Kyle Connor and Gabriel Vilardi scored for Winnipeg, who snapped a two-game losing streak.
Mark Scheifele had a pair of assists for the Jets.
Winnipeg moved to 28-12-2.
Roman Josi had a goal and an assist for the Predators.
Filip Forsberg had the other Nashville goal.
Juuse Saros turned aside 26 shots for Nashville, who dropped to 13-21-7.
Morgan Barron scored 6:30 into the first to give the Jets the lead when he stuffed the puck past Saros during a goalmouth scramble.
The goal was his 4th of the season.
Josh Morrissey gave Winnipeg a two-goal lead 16 seconds later after taking a Dylan DeMelo feed before stepping into a slapshot from the left faceoff circle and beating Saros high glove side.
The goal was his 5th of the season.
Kyle Connor scored at 18:36, when Mark Scheifele caught him cruising through the slot and slid him the puck from the right side boards.
Connor beat Saros with a short side wrister from the top of the faceoff circle to make it 3-0 Winnipeg.
The goal was his 23rd of the season.
Filip Forsberg scored on the power play at 16:45 to get Nashville on the board when he converted a Roman Josi feed past Hellebuyck, beating the Jets netminder with a low wrister.
The goal was his 10th of the season.
Gabriel Vilardi scored 13 seconds into a power play when he neatly tipped a Nikolaj Ehlers feed past Saros at 7:51 of the third period.
The tally was his 19th of the season.
Roman Josi cut the Winnipeg lead in half at 9:25 when he scored off a slapshot that ricocheted off of Jet defenceman Logan Stanley's skate to make it 4-2.
The goal was his 8th of the season.
Nashville had a two-man advantage for 1:28 in the third period when Kyle Connor took a hooking penalty while the Jets were shorthanded with just under seven minutes left in regulation but were unable to score.
Overall the Predators power play sputtered, going 1-7 with the man advantage on the night, a fact not lost on Preds Head Coach Andrew Brunette. “I think when you're 1-for-7, you get a 5-on-3 and you don't score, that always stings a little bit. Besides that, I think for the most part, most of the time I like what we were doing. We didn't get rewarded. You know, I think there's little stretches there where we got a little bit, I guess, sloppy with the puck. We were a little bit slow to move it. We probably left plays out there. That's always frustrating when you're on the power play, watching the power play, when that happens. But, you know, it's been that kind of stretch for us," he said.
Nino Niederreiter flipped the disc into an empty net at 17:55 to seal the win for the Jets.
